diff --git a/.github/workflows/lint.yml b/.github/workflows/lint.yml index 6c2f2f9..4ab5d8a 100644 --- a/.github/workflows/lint.yml +++ b/.github/workflows/lint.yml @@ -13,20 +13,21 @@ on: jobs: trunk-quality: runs-on: ubuntu-latest + permissions: + checks: write + contents: write steps: - name: Checkout repo uses: actions/checkout@v4 - name: Install Trunk - run: | - curl -fsSL https://get.trunk.io -o- | bash - echo "$HOME/.trunk/bin" >> $GITHUB_PATH + uses: trunk-io/trunk-action/setup@v1 - name: Run Trunk Autofix run: trunk fmt . - name: Trunk Code Review & Lint - run: trunk check + uses: trunk-io/trunk-action@v1 # Optionally commit autofixes - name: Commit changes